Get answers to common questions about Deep Tissue Massage – 120 Mins.
The pressure used is typically intense, aiming to release chronic tension, but your comfort is prioritized. You can communicate with your therapist during the session.
While many people benefit, those with certain medical conditions should consult a physician before receiving deep tissue massage.
It’s common to feel a mix of soreness and relaxation. Drinking plenty of water post-session can help ease any discomfort.
Absolutely! You’re encouraged to communicate your needs and particularly tight or sore areas to your therapist.
For chronic pain or tension, a bi-weekly or monthly schedule can be beneficial. However, individual needs may vary.
Arrive 10-15 minutes early to complete any necessary paperwork and take time to relax before the session begins.
